Flowers and a toy paper plane are seen in front of the Iranian embassy in a tribute to the airplane crash victims in Kiev, Ukraine.
Many families, several young children, and a number of students who were among the victims of a Ukraine International Airlines crash were either Canadian citizens or were travelling to Canada.
Flight PS752 — an American-made Boeing 737-800 — crashed early Wednesday morning local time, minutes after taking off from Tehran’s main airport early on its way to Kyiv. The crash killed all 176 passengers and crew on board, Ukrainian officials said.
